Check Digit Verification of cas no

The CAS Registry Mumber 434957-19-4 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 4,3,4,9,5 and 7 respectively; the second part has 2 digits, 1 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 434957-19:
(8*4)+(7*3)+(6*4)+(5*9)+(4*5)+(3*7)+(2*1)+(1*9)=174
174 % 10 = 4
So 434957-19-4 is a valid CAS Registry Number.

Arylations of substituted enamides by aryl iodides: Regio- and stereoselective synthesis of (z)-β-amido-β-arylacrylates

Gou, Quan,Deng, Bin,Zhang, Hongbin,Qin, Jun

supporting information, p. 4604 - 4607 (2013/09/24)

Arylations of substituted enamides by aryl iodides were achieved for the first time via an unusual PdCl2(COD)/Ag3PO4 catalytic system. A broad range of (Z)-β-amido-β-arylacrylates were prepared regio- and stereoselectively in a highly efficient manner.

Highly effective chiral ortho-substituted BINAPO ligands (o-BINAPO): Applications in Ru-catalyzed asymmetric hydrogenations of β-aryl-substituted β-(acylamino)acrylates and β-keto esters

Zhou, Yong-Gui,Tang, Wenjun,Wang, Wen-Bo,Li, Wenge,Zhang, Xumu

, p. 4952 - 4953 (2007/10/03)

A novel family of chiral ortho-substituted BINAPO ligands (o-BINAPO) were synthesized from BINOL, and their Ru complexes were highly efficient catalysts for asymmetric hydrogenation of β-aryl-substituted β-(acylamino)acrylates and β-aryl-substituted β-keto esters. The Ru-bisphosphinite catalysts can tolerate an E/Z mixture of β-aryl-substituted β-(acylamino)acrylates. These highly enantioselective hydrogenations provide a useful way to prepare β-aryl-substituted β-amino acids and β-hydroxyl acids. Copyright
